Thread Inhalte eines Arrays tauschen
(6 answers)
Opened by User100 at 2010-02-12 11:56
Hallo zusammen,
Ich möchste gerne die Elemente(Index) in einem Array tauschen. Das Array geht von 1-100. Code (perl): (dl
)
1 2 3 4 5 6 7 8 9 10 11 12 13 14 15 16 17 my @a=(1..100); my $i=0; my $end=@a; my $tauschA; my $tauschB; print "Gehordnet: $end \n"; foreach(@a){ ($a[$i],$a[$i+1]) = ($a[$i+1],$a[$i]); #print "@a \n"; $i++; print "Anzahl pro Zeile: $i \n"; last if($i==$end) } print "Ganzes Array: @a \n"; print $i; Leider funktionieren nur die ersten beiden? Aber warum? Die Schleife wird 100 Mal durchlaufen. |